To allow hazards to separate when meeting traffic, you can maintain a safe following distance, ensuring there is enough space to react to sudden stops or obstacles. Additionally, using turn signals well in advance can alert other drivers of your intentions, reducing the likelihood of unexpected maneuvers. Furthermore, scanning the road ahead for potential hazards, such as pedestrians or cyclists, allows for timely adjustments in speed or position. Lastly, staying within your lane and adhering to traffic laws helps minimize risks during encounters with other vehicles.

Searching for hazards in traffic primarily depends on a driver's awareness and attentiveness to their surroundings. Factors such as visibility, road conditions, and the behavior of other drivers significantly influence hazard detection. Additionally, a driver's experience and training play crucial roles in recognizing potential dangers effectively. Overall, maintaining focus and being proactive are essential for identifying hazards in traffic.

Another name for a traffic cone is a traffic delineator. They are often used to channelize traffic, mark hazards, or indicate construction zones. Other terms can include road cone or safety cone, depending on the context.
